1. Optimize Thermostat Settings For Efficiency

To optimize your HVAC system’s efficiency, start by adjusting your thermostat settings. Set it to a higher temperature in the summer and lower in the winter to reduce energy consumption. Consider investing in a programmable or smart thermostat for more precise control over your home’s temperature. By fine-tuning these settings, you can ensure your HVAC system operates efficiently, keeping your indoor air comfortable while lowering your energy bills. 2. Regular DIY Maintenance Tips

Regular DIY maintenance is vital for your HVAC system’s longevity. Start by cleaning or replacing filters every 1-3 months to ensure optimal airflow and indoor air quality. Check and seal any leaks in ductwork, and consider scheduling a professional duct cleaning service to prevent energy wastage and improve indoor air quality. Inspect outdoor units for debris and ensure proper clearance for efficient operation. Lastly, consider trimming nearby foliage and keeping the area clean for unhindered airflow. These simple maintenance tasks, including duct cleaning, can enhance your HVAC system’s efficiency and lifespan, saving you money in the long run. 3. Seal And Insulate Ductwork Properly

Sealing and insulating ductwork properly is crucial for optimizing your HVAC system’s efficiency. By ensuring that your ducts are well-sealed and insulated, you can prevent air leaks and minimize energy waste. This simple step helps maintain a more consistent temperature throughout your home, reducing the workload on your HVAC system and saving you money in the long run. Properly sealed and insulated ducts also contribute to better indoor air quality by preventing dust and pollutants from entering your living spaces. 4. Upgrade To A Smart Thermostat

By upgrading to a smart thermostat, you can significantly enhance your HVAC system’s efficiency. Smart thermostats allow for precise temperature control, scheduling, and remote adjustments, optimizing energy usage based on your lifestyle. This technology ensures that your HVAC runs only when necessary, leading to energy savings over time. Smart thermostats also provide insights into your usage patterns, enabling you to make informed decisions to further improve your system’s performance. Consider this upgrade to experience a more personalized and energy-efficient indoor climate.

5. Use Ceiling Fans To Assist HVAC Efficiency

By strategically using ceiling fans in conjunction with your HVAC system, you can enhance energy efficiency and improve overall comfort levels in your Lexington, KY home. During the summer, set your ceiling fans to rotate counterclockwise to create a cool breeze, allowing you to raise the thermostat temperature without sacrificing comfort. In the winter, reverse the fan direction to clockwise at a low speed to push warm air downwards and circulate it throughout the room, reducing the workload on your efficient air conditioning system. Understanding Your HVAC System’s Energy Consumption

Understanding your HVAC system’s energy consumption is essential for making informed decisions about energy-saving measures. Here’s what you need to know about energy consumption:

Your HVAC system’s energy consumption is influenced by several factors, including:

  • The size and efficiency of your HVAC system: A properly sized and energy-efficient HVAC system will consume less energy to heat or cool your home compared to an oversized or inefficient system.
  • The insulation and sealing of your home: A well-insulated and properly sealed home will require less energy to maintain a comfortable indoor temperature.
  • The climate in Lexington, KY: The local climate plays a significant role in determining the energy consumption of your HVAC system. Hotter summers and colder winters may lead to increased energy usage.

To reduce energy consumption:

  • Consider upgrading to a high-efficiency HVAC system that is properly sized for your home.
  • Improve insulation and seal any air leaks in your home to reduce energy loss.
  • Use energy-saving features, such as programmable thermostats and zone control, to optimize temperature settings and minimize energy usage.

By understanding your HVAC system’s energy consumption, you can make informed decisions about energy-saving measures and take steps to reduce your energy usage, lower your utility bills, and contribute to a more sustainable environment.

DIY HVAC Maintenance Guide

Regular maintenance is crucial for keeping your HVAC system running smoothly and efficiently. As a homeowner, there are several DIY maintenance tasks you can perform to ensure optimal performance and energy efficiency. Here’s a comprehensive DIY HVAC maintenance guide:

Cleaning And Replacing Filters Regularly

Cleaning and replacing air filters regularly is one of the most important maintenance tasks for your HVAC system. Here’s why it’s essential:

  • Dirty filters restrict airflow, making your HVAC system work harder and consume more energy.
  • Clogged filters can negatively impact indoor air quality by allowing dust and allergens to circulate throughout your home.
  • Check your filters monthly and clean or replace them as needed. Disposable filters should be replaced every 1-3 months, while washable filters can be cleaned and reused.

Checking And Sealing Leaks In Ductwork

Inspecting and sealing leaks in your ductwork is another important DIY maintenance task. Here’s how you can do it:

  • Start by visually inspecting your ductwork for any visible leaks or gaps.
  • Use foil tape or mastic sealant to seal small leaks or gaps. For larger gaps, consider using metal-backed tape or hire a professional for duct sealing.
  • Properly sealed ductwork prevents conditioned air from escaping, improving energy efficiency and reducing energy waste.

By performing regular DIY maintenance tasks like cleaning and replacing filters and checking and sealing leaks in ductwork, you can keep your HVAC system running efficiently, improve indoor air quality, and save energy.
